== Gameplay ==
== Gameplay ==
Taken Incendiors wield the Orphic Flame Caster, which charges up before firing a long-ranged, explosive [[Void]] fireball that leaves a pool of burning flames in the impact area. They fight from a distance, preferring to hang back near their allies whilst they bombard enemies with fireballs. They cannot perform the Compression Blast of their counterparts, but in its place gain the ability to unleash an Umbral Surge, an AoE blast that deals heavy Void damage and applies a Burn effect. Allies who are caught in the Umbral Surge will become surrounded in an aura of purple flames, and they will deal greater damage whilst continuously regenerating health for a short time. Allies who are still under the effects of the Umbral Surge will leave behind pools of fire upon being slain.

Their fuel tanks are no longer an additional weak spot, and they gain the ability to teleport short distances at a cost to their jump jets.
